#b56b50 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#b56b50 is composed of 71% red, 42% green and 31.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 40.9% magenta, 55.8% yellow and 29% black. It has a hue angle of 16 degrees, a saturation of 40.6% and a lightness of 51.2%. #b56b50 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ffd6a0 with #6b0000. Closest websafe color is: #cc6666.

#b56b50 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#b56b50 has RGB values of R:181, G:107, B:80 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.41, Y:0.56, K:0.29. Its decimal value is 11889488.

Shades and Tints of #b56b50
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#040202 is the darkest color, while #fbf7f5 is the lightest one.
